Lately, test function breaking down (EMD), the well-known investigation technique for nonlinear and also non-stationary indicators, has been used for the purpose of ECG noise decrease. Within this study, an altered EMD, attire empirical function breaking down (EEMD), was utilized regarding ECG sound decrease. Further Gaussian sound has been employed, as well as the actual EMD procedure, as well as the typical (attire) innate setting perform (IMF) was applied regarding ECG reconstruction. On this research, a few high rate of recurrence ECG noises, muscles pulling, 50/60 Hertz power collection items in the way and also simulated Gaussian sound were looked at. Imply square error (MSE) in between strained ECG along with clear ECG was used being a recouvrement performance catalog. Final results demonstrated that the first or even the initial two IMF levels had been deleted as a result of their noise parts, whereas the other ensemble IMF constituted thoroughly clean ECG elements regarding ECG recouvrement. The MSE involving EEMD is less as opposed to MSE associated with EMD and infinite behavioral instinct result (IIR) filtering upon these three noise sorts because of the reduction of mode-mixing result involving distinct IMFs. Genetic methyltransferase 1 (DNMT1) will be the principal enzyme that will preserves DNA methylation during duplication. Dysregulation involving DNMT1 is actually suggested as a factor in many different ailments. DNMT1 health proteins steadiness is actually controlled via various post-translational alterations, for example acetylation along with ubiquitination, and also via protein-protein connections. These types of systems ensure DNMT1 is properly initialized during the perfect time of the cellular never-ending cycle and also at proper genomic loci, plus in a reaction to proper extracellular tips. Methicillin-resistant Staphylococcus aureus (MRSA), an intricate regarding multidrug-resistant Gram-positive bacterial traces, has proven specially difficult in both medical center as well as community configurations by simply deactivating standard beta-lactam prescription antibiotics, including penicillins, cephalosporins, and carbapenems, through a variety of elements, leading to improved mortality costs and stay in hospital charges. Have a look at present a class regarding charged metallopolymers in which demonstrate complete consequences towards MRSA simply by proficiently suppressing action associated with beta-lactamase along with effectively lysing bacterial cellular material. Numerous standard beta-lactam antibiotics, including penicillin-G, amoxicillin, ampicillin, along with cefazolin, are protected coming from beta-lactamase hydrolysis through the formation of distinctive ion-pairs among their carboxylate anions along with cationic cobaltocenium moieties. These kinds of developments might supply a fresh walkway pertaining to planning macromolecular scaffolds to regrow energy source involving traditional prescription antibiotics for you to destroy multidrug-resistant microorganisms along with superbugs.
